More than two dozen cats are looking for their “furever” family.
Dakin Humane Society in Springfield has 24 cats listed as available on their adoption page, with some of the cats waiting to find families for months.
One of those cats is Eugene, who is described as being a “total love bug.”
“His favorite hobbies include looking out the window, playing with ping pong balls and feasting on catnip,” the website reads. “Sometimes loud sounds and movements scare him, perhaps reminding him of the stray life, where he never knew if friend or foe lurked around the corner.”
The cat will need to be the only pet in the house, Dakin Humane Society said.
“Eugene has a lot of love to give but will need someone who is willing to let him move at his own pace,” the website states.

He also has FIV, which is a cat-only virus and does not affect people or dogs.
“FIV+ cats most often live long, healthy, and relatively normal lives with no symptoms at all. FIV is not easily passed between cats,” the websites reads.
He is available for adoption for $50.
